Yarn in Dundee, IL Just Paint IncPO Box 811Dundee, IL, 601188474269341Arts And Crafts StoresArts Crafts SuppliesCommercial Painting ContractorsCraft StoresDupont Paint SuppliesHobbyPainting Contractors ResidentialYarn ShopYarn ShopsYarn StoreYarn Stores Show More